Description:

This position maintains the Bank's delinquent accounts at an acceptable level. This position ensures that all repossessions, foreclosures, and collections are handled in a fair, considerate, and professional manner and that we are in compliance with all laws and regulations. This position is part of the Collection Team and works closely with other departments.

Primary Duties:

  • Receive and review a computerized listing of all delinquent loans daily that you are assigned to work.
  • Report the status and any workout arrangement on the delinquent accounts in the Collection software.
  • Communicate with delinquent borrowers, attempting to obtain late payments, using various means of contact such as telephone, letters, and personal visits. This individual will primarily be responsible for collection of consumer purpose loans and/or residential real estate loans. This individual will also be responsible for overseeing the collection efforts of other assigned portfolios.
  • Utilize methods of collection under terms of the loan contract depending on the feasibility and applicability of each case if initial collection attempts do not secure required payment. This may entail extending due dates or refinancing of delinquent loans with input from the officer and their manager. This also may involve repossessing the collateral on secured items if the delinquent situation requires such action.
  • Properly document all collection calls, promises by the customer, any action taken, etc. Documentation must be in compliance with requirements of rules and regulations for specific portfolios (such as repossessions, foreclosures or FNMA loans).
  • Oversee repossessions on assigned accounts to ensure they are handled in a satisfactory manner. Document all notices sent to the customer, inspections of the repossessed property, sale of the repossessed property, and follow up on any deficiency balance.
  • Assist in the administration of consumer bankruptcy. Work with the bankruptcy trustee on any reaffirmation agreements, workout agreements, surrendering of the collateral, etc.
  • Assist with administering the Bank's overdraft policy. Monitor overdrawn checking accounts and work with the appropriate officer to collect or charge off accounts as needed. Determine when the accounts will be charged off and sent to collection and Chex Systems.
  • Submit charged off loan accounts for collection when all of collection efforts have been exhausted.
  • Work with Deposit Services on levies/garnishments to determine the bank's rights and whether we will apply any available funds towards the levy/garnishment or loans in default at the bank. Communicate with Deposit Services and Loan Servicing - Payment Processing on the application of funds and notices required to be provided to the customer or the entity presenting the levy/garnishment.
  • Work with the Special Assets Manager, SVP/Loan Administration and the Bank's legal counsel on any loans where foreclosure proceedings may need to be initiated. Ensure Bell Bank is in compliance with all applicable laws and regulations as well as accounting guidelines.
  • Assist Commercial/Ag Loan Officers on the collection of commercial/agricultural loans on an as needed basis. This may include attending meetings with the customer and legal counsel to determine an appropriate workout plan.
  • Assist the Special Asset Manager in the preparation of the Problem Loan Agendas for the departments/locations that are assigned to you.
